/* Copyright (C) 2014-2024 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
Copying and distribution of this script, with or without modification,
are permitted in any medium without royalty provided the copyright
notice and this notice are preserved. */
/* SPDX-License-Identifier: MPL-2.0 AND FSFAP */
OUTPUT_FORMAT("elf32-littlearm", "elf32-bigarm", "elf32-littlearm")
OUTPUT_ARCH(arm)
ENTRY(_start)
/* User-configurable symbols. */
/* The size, in bytes, of the amount of shared WRAM used by ARM7 code. */
/* Only 0 and 32768 are valid values. */
PROVIDE(__shared_wram_size = 16384);
ASSERT(__shared_wram_size == 0 || __shared_wram_size == 16384, "ARM7 shared WRAM size must be 0 KB or 32 KB");
/* The size, in bytes, of the reserved section at the end of IWRAM. */
/* Traditionally, ARM7 reserves 0x40 bytes here. */
PROVIDE(__iwram_reserved_size = 0x40);
ASSERT((__iwram_reserved_size & 3) == 0, "__iwram_reserved_size must be a multiple of 4");
/* ARM supervisor (SWI calls) stack size. */
PROVIDE(__svc_stack_size = 0x100);
ASSERT((__svc_stack_size & 3) == 0, "__svc_stack_size must be a multiple of 4");
/* ARM interrupt handler stack size. */
PROVIDE(__irq_stack_size = 0x100);
ASSERT((__irq_stack_size & 3) == 0, "__irq_stack_size must be a multiple of 4");
PHDRS {
crt0 PT_LOAD FLAGS(7);
arm7 PT_LOAD FLAGS(7);
arm7i PT_LOAD FLAGS(0x100007); /* (DSi flag for ndstool | 7) */
}
MEMORY {
ewram : ORIGIN = 0x02380000, LENGTH = 12M - 512K
iwram : ORIGIN = 0x03800000 - __shared_wram_size, LENGTH = 65536 + __shared_wram_size
twl_ewram : ORIGIN = 0x02e80000, LENGTH = 512K - 64K
twl_iwram : ORIGIN = 0x03000000, LENGTH = 256K
}
__iwram_start = ORIGIN(iwram);
__iwram_top = ORIGIN(iwram) + LENGTH(iwram);
__sp_irq = __iwram_top - __iwram_reserved_size;
__sp_svc = __sp_irq - __irq_stack_size;
__sp_usr = __sp_svc - __svc_stack_size;
__irq_flags = 0x04000000 - 8;
__irq_flagsaux = 0x04000000 - 0x40;
__irq_vector = 0x04000000 - 4;
SECTIONS
{
.twl :
{
__arm7i_lma__ = LOADADDR(.twl);
__arm7i_start__ = .;
*(.twl)
*(.twl.text .twl.text.*)
*(.twl.rodata .twl.rodata.*)
*(.twl.data .twl.data.*)
*.twl*(.text .stub .text.* .gnu.linkonce.t.*)
*.twl*(.rodata)
*.twl*(.roda)
*.twl*(.rodata.*)
*.twl*(.data)
*.twl*(.data.*)
*.twl*(.gnu.linkonce.d*)
. = ALIGN(4);
__arm7i_end__ = .;
} >twl_iwram AT>twl_ewram :arm7i
.twl_bss ALIGN(4) (NOLOAD) :
{
__twl_bss_start__ = .;
*(.twl_bss .twl_bss.*)
*(.twl.bss .twl.bss.*)
*.twl.*(.dynbss)
*.twl.*(.gnu.linkonce.b*)
*.twl.*(.bss*)
*.twl.*(COMMON)
. = ALIGN(4);
__twl_bss_end__ = .;
} >twl_iwram :NONE
.twl_noinit ALIGN(4) (NOLOAD):
{
__twl_noinit_start__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.twl_noinit .twl_noinit.*)
*(.twl.noinit .twl.noinit.*)
*.twl*(.noinit)
*.twl*(.noinit.*)
*.twl*(.gnu.linkonce.n.*)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
__twl_noinit_end__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
__twl_end__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
} >twl_iwram :NONE
.crt0 :
{
KEEP (*(.crt0))
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>ewram :crt0
.text :
{
__arm7_lma__ = LOADADDR(.text);
__arm7_start__ = .;
KEEP (*(SORT_NONE(.init)))
*(.plt)
*(.text .stub .text.* .gnu.linkonce.t.*)
KEEP (*(.text.*personality*))
/* .gnu.warning sections are handled specially by elf32.em. */
*(.gnu.warning)
*(.glue_7t) *(.glue_7) *(.v4_bx)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ram :arm7
.fini :
{
KEEP (*(.fini))
} >iwram AT>ewram
.rodata :
{
*(.rodata)
*all.rodata*(*)
*(.roda)
*(.rodata.*)
*(.gnu.linkonce.r*)
SORT(CONSTRUCTORS)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ram
.ARM.extab : { *(.ARM.extab* .gnu.linkonce.armextab.*) } >iwram AT>ewram
.ARM.exidx : {
__exidx_start = .;
*(.ARM.exidx* .gnu.linkonce.armexidx.*)
__exidx_end = .;
} >iwram AT>ewram
/* Ensure the __preinit_array_start label is properly aligned. We
could instead move the label definition inside the section, but
the linker would then create the section even if it turns out to
be empty, which isn't pretty. */
. = ALIGN(32 / 8);
.init_array :
{
PROVIDE (__preinit_array_start = .);
PROVIDE (__bothinit_array_start = .);
KEEP (*(.preinit_array))
PROVIDE (__preinit_array_end = .);
PROVIDE (__init_array_start = .);
KEEP (*(SORT_BY_INIT_PRIORITY(.init_array.*) SORT_BY_INIT_PRIORITY(.ctors.*)))
KEEP (*(.init_array EXCLUDE_FILE (*crtbegin.o *crtbegin?.o *crtend.o *crtend?.o ) .ctors))
PROVIDE (__init_array_end = .);
PROVIDE (__bothinit_array_end = .);
} >iwram AT>ewram
.fini_array :
{
PROVIDE (__fini_array_start = .);
KEEP (*(SORT_BY_INIT_PRIORITY(.fini_array.*) SORT_BY_INIT_PRIORITY(.dtors.*)))
KEEP (*(.fini_array EXCLUDE_FILE (*crtbegin.o *crtbegin?.o *crtend.o *crtend?.o ) .dtors))
/* Required by pico-exitprocs.c. */
KEEP (*(.fini_array*))
PROVIDE (__fini_array_end = .);
} >iwram AT>ewram
.ctors :
{
/* gcc uses crtbegin.o to find the start of
the constructors, so we make sure it is
first. Because this is a wildcard, it
doesn't matter if the user does not
actually link against crtbegin.o; the
linker won't look for a file to match a
wildcard. The wildcard also means that it
doesn't matter which directory crtbegin.o
is in. */
KEEP (*crtbegin.o(.ctors))
KEEP (*crtbegin?.o(.ctors))
/* We don't want to include the .ctor section from
the crtend.o file until after the sorted ctors.
The .ctor section from the crtend file contains the
end of ctors marker and it must be last */
KEEP (*(EXCLUDE_FILE (*crtend.o *crtend?.o ) .ctors))
KEEP (*(SORT(.ctors.*)))
KEEP (*(.ctors))
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ram
.dtors :
{
KEEP (*crtbegin.o(.dtors))
KEEP (*crtbegin?.o(.dtors))
KEEP (*(EXCLUDE_FILE (*crtend.o *crtend?.o ) .dtors))
KEEP (*(SORT(.dtors.*)))
KEEP (*(.dtors))
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ram
.eh_frame :
{
KEEP (*(.eh_frame))
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ram
.gcc_except_table :
{
*(.gcc_except_table .gcc_except_table.*)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
} >iwram AT>ewram
.got : { *(.got.plt) *(.got) } >iwram AT>ewram
.data ALIGN(4) : {
__data_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.data)
*(.data.*)
*(.gnu.linkonce.d*)
CONSTRUCTORS
. = ALIGN(4);
} >iwram AT>ewram
.tdata ALIGN(4) :
{
__tdata_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.tdata .tdata.* .gnu.linkonce.td.*)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
__tdata_end = ABSOLUTE(.);
__data_end = . ;
} >iwram AT>ewram
__tdata_size = __tdata_end - __tdata_start ;
.tbss ALIGN(4) (NOLOAD) :
{
__tbss_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.tbss .tbss.* .gnu.linkonce.tb.*)
*(.tcommon)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
__tbss_end = ABSOLUTE(.);
} >iwram AT>ewram
__tbss_size = __tbss_end - __tbss_start ;
.bss ALIGN(4) (NOLOAD) :
{
__arm7_end__ = .;
__bss_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
__bss_start__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.dynbss)
*(.gnu.linkonce.b*)
*(.bss*)
*(COMMON)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
__bss_end__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
} >iwram
.noinit (NOLOAD):
{
__noinit_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
*(.noinit .noinit.* .gnu.linkonce.n.*)
. = ALIGN(4); /* REQUIRED. LD is flaky without it. */
__noinit_end = ABSOLUTE(.);
} >iwram
/* Space reserved for the thread local storage of main() */
.tls ALIGN(4) (NOLOAD) :
{
__tls_start = ABSOLUTE(.);
. = . + __tdata_size + __tbss_size;
__tls_end = ABSOLUTE(.);
__end__ = ABSOLUTE(.);
} >iwram
__tls_size = __tls_end - __tls_start;
HIDDEN(__arm7_size__ = __arm7_end__ - __arm7_start__);
HIDDEN(__arm7i_size__ = __arm7i_end__ - __arm7i_start__);
HIDDEN(__bss_size__ = __bss_end__ - __bss_start__);
HIDDEN(__twl_bss_size__ = __twl_bss_end__ - __twl_bss_start__);
/* Stabs debugging sections. */
.stab 0 : { *(.stab) }
.stabstr 0 : { *(.stabstr) }
.stab.excl 0 : { *(.stab.excl) }
.stab.exclstr 0 : { *(.stab.exclstr) }
.stab.index 0 : { *(.stab.index) }
.stab.indexstr 0 : { *(.stab.indexstr) }
.comment 0 (INFO) : { *(.comment); LINKER_VERSION; }
.gnu.build.attributes : { *(.gnu.build.attributes .gnu.build.attributes.*) }
/* DWARF debug sections.
Symbols in the DWARF debugging sections are relative to the beginning
of the section so we begin them at 0. */
/* DWARF 1. */
.debug 0 : { *(.debug) }
.line 0 : { *(.line) }
/* GNU DWARF 1 extensions. */
.debug_srcinfo 0 : { *(.debug_srcinfo) }
.debug_sfnames 0 : { *(.debug_sfnames) }
/* DWARF 1.1 and DWARF 2. */
.debug_aranges 0 : { *(.debug_aranges) }
.debug_pubnames 0 : { *(.debug_pubnames) }
/* DWARF 2. */
.debug_info 0 : { *(.debug_info .gnu.linkonce.wi.*) }
.debug_abbrev 0 : { *(.debug_abbrev) }
.debug_line 0 : { *(.debug_line .debug_line.* .debug_line_end) }
.debug_frame 0 : { *(.debug_frame) }
.debug_str 0 : { *(.debug_str) }
.debug_loc 0 : { *(.debug_loc) }
.debug_macinfo 0 : { *(.debug_macinfo) }
/* SGI/MIPS DWARF 2 extensions. */
.debug_weaknames 0 : { *(.debug_weaknames) }
.debug_funcnames 0 : { *(.debug_funcnames) }
.debug_typenames 0 : { *(.debug_typenames) }
.debug_varnames 0 : { *(.debug_varnames) }
/* DWARF 3. */
.debug_pubtypes 0 : { *(.debug_pubtypes) }
.debug_ranges 0 : { *(.debug_ranges) }
/* DWARF 5. */
.debug_addr 0 : { *(.debug_addr) }
.debug_line_str 0 : { *(.debug_line_str) }
.debug_loclists 0 : { *(.debug_loclists) }
.debug_macro 0 : { *(.debug_macro) }
.debug_names 0 : { *(.debug_names) }
.debug_rnglists 0 : { *(.debug_rnglists) }
.debug_str_offsets 0 : { *(.debug_str_offsets) }
.debug_sup 0 : { *(.debug_sup) }
.ARM.attributes 0 : { KEEP (*(.ARM.attributes)) KEEP (*(.gnu.attributes)) }
.note.gnu.arm.ident 0 : { KEEP (*(.note.gnu.arm.ident)) }
/DISCARD/ : { *(.note.GNU-stack) *(.gnu_debuglink) *(.gnu.lto_*) }
}
